However, to give it even … In early U.S. colonial history, teaching children to read was the responsibility of the parents for the purpose of reading the Bible. The Massachusetts law of 1642 and the Connecticut law of 1650 required that not only children but also servants and apprentices were required to learn to read. http://uis.unesco.org/en/topic/literacy Web5 dec. 2024 · It assesses adults’ proficiency in three domains: literacy, numeracy, and problem-solving in technology-rich environments. In each of these domains, adults perform tasks with different levels of complexity. Their skills with these tasks are quantified and categorized into proficiency levels.
